Benipatti is an assembly constituency in Madhubani district in the Indian state of Bihar.
As per Delimitation of Parliamentary and Assembly constituencies Order, 2008, No. 32. Benipatti Assembly constituency is composed of the following: Kaluahi community development block; Bishunpur, Basaitha, Behata, Bankata, Pali, Parsauna, Dhagjara, Barhampura, Akaur, Nagwas, Naokarhi, Chatra, Parkhauli Tikuli, Anrer South, Anrer North, Paraul, Parjuar Dih, Dhanga, Mureth, Nagdah Balain, Kapasia, Barri, Shahpur, Meghben, Benipatti, Ganguli and Kataia gram panchayats of Benipatti CD Block. There is a dominance of Brahmin voters in Benipatti assembly, that is why mostly MLAs from Brahmin community are elected here.
Benipatti Assembly constituency is part of No. 6. Madhubani (Lok Sabha constituency).
Benipatti Assembly constituency known as Benipatti East and Benipatti West from 1952 to 1967.
